Hello, I noticed since yesterday afternoon that my Avast Online Security Browser Extension has not been blocking trackers, which it always has been doing. I tried uninstalling and re-installing it, but it still is not blocking trackers.

I use Firefox (the most current version (108.0.2, 64-bit).

I also have the most recent version of Avast Free (22.12.6044, build 22.12.7758.768).

It is also saying on Security Browser Extension "Get Avast One Premium to turn on tracking prevention and automatically block trackers as you browse the web." Does this mean the tracking prevention is no longer free?

Please help. Thanks in advance.

If you click the AOSP icon on Firefox, a popup will appear stating:
"Prevent tracking on all websites
Get Avast One Premium to turn on tracking prevention and automatically block trackers as you browse the web."

So I read that as AOSP detects, but does not block Trackers.

Maybe consider adding uBlock Origin extension to your Firefox.
